Special Weather Statement issued June 29 at 7:13PM CDT by NWS Midland/Odessa TX

Details

At 713 PM CDT, Doppler radar was tracking strong thunderstorms along
a line extending from near Goldsmith to near West Odessa to 15 miles
east of Monahans. Movement was northeast at 20 mph.

HAZARD…Wind gusts up to 50 mph and pea size hail.

SOURCE…Radar indicated.

IMPACT…Gusty winds could knock down tree limbs and blow around
unsecured objects. Minor hail damage to vegetation is
possible.

Locations impacted include…
Odessa, Goldsmith, West Odessa, Odessa Schlemeyer Field, Penwell, and
Pleasant Farms.

This includes Interstate 20 between mile markers 96 and 116.

Instructions

If outdoors, consider seeking shelter inside a building.

Frequent cloud to ground lightning is occurring with these storms.
Lightning can strike 10 miles away from a thunderstorm. Seek a safe
shelter inside a building or vehicle.
